Lenses are optical components designed to manipulate light rays by refraction, dispersion, or focusing. In electronics applications, lenses are used to control and shape light emitted by LEDs, lasers, sensors, and imaging systems. Lenses can be fabricated from various materials, including glass, plastics, and specialized optical polymers, and they come in a wide range of shapes, sizes, and optical properties to suit different applications. Lens designs may include convex, concave, aspheric, cylindrical, and fresnel profiles, each tailored to specific optical requirements such as collimation, diffusion, magnification, or beam shaping.
